Follow SMF on Twitter.
Started by texasman1979, April 27, 2011, 01:38:18 PM
Quote from: texasman1979 on April 27, 2011, 01:38:18 PMEveryone knows what windows update is as well as apt-get in linux. Id like to see in 3.0 a package manager linked to its own mods site. The package manager would display all installed mods, but also with a ping, display current versions with the ability to upgrade the mod if it is an old version. Also sub-version upgrades can be installed through it as well, ie *.1 or *.2. With this package manager, there would be a button to view/search for available mods and the ability to install then directly from the mod site. Download and install in a single click rather than downloading a zip and then uploading to the server then refreshing the package manager page, then installing the mod, etc. This idea would make simple machines mods that much more simple.
QuoteI'm not aware of problems of Ubuntu having a commercial community because of apt-get.
Quoteyou have to have an actual mod interface in order to have a smf apt-get.
Quoteand as far as the upgrades of future existing mods, not that hard to code an uninstall of the old and install the new.
Quotewhat im pushing is a whole new way of looking at modding and the act of installing and using those mods.
Quoteand this in itself will mold the rest of the software to be better, totally cause of the modular design necessary to achieve it.
Quoteif you build an environment that is, within reason, easily changed, the quantity and quality of the mods will blow our minds.
Quotebig mods, little mods, they would all have a place as long as the receptacle of those ideas is designed to receive them.
Quotehave just a basic software sitting there. then a built in method to to modify it, in any way. then plugin what you want. its designed for it.
Quotethen you have a great many sites out there that are all based off the same core, but can do virtually anything.
Quotetake out the "core" features, and make them mods as well.
Quotemake it where people in as simple of a way as possible, build the site how they want it to be.
Quoteif this is made the goal, i think with a reasonable amount of care and effort, it can be made to happen.
Quotean array is a list of variables, a class is an array of functions and arrays, and a collection is an array of classes.
Quoteyou cant tell me that built in that way, just about everything couldn't be changed dynamically to suit the user.
Quotei hope someone can see the vision i have. i would kill to see it in reality.
QuoteAre yall saying that we have reached the extent of what we are capable of doing? The whole point is to push the envelope and drag lazy people with us. Is it not?
Quote from: texasman1979 on April 29, 2011, 10:54:22 AMThe general population will no doubt follow the lead of the pioneer.
Quote from: texasman1979 on April 29, 2011, 10:54:22 AMIt similar, in concept, to dreamweaver or visual studio. The tools where made and the entire world is different and better because of it.
Quote from: texasman1979 on April 29, 2011, 10:54:22 AMWhat im suggesting is build a core that is totally dynamic, and designed to be manipulated.
Quote from: texasman1979 on April 29, 2011, 10:54:22 AMThen in conjunction to that, build in all the tools necessary for both novice and professional programmers to modify how they wish. Then provide an area where the end user can readily and quickly setup the site how ever they wish.
Quote from: texasman1979 on April 29, 2011, 10:54:22 AMthink of an exe with a bunch of dlls. When upgrades take place, the dlls are replaced, not modified.
Quote from: texasman1979 on April 29, 2011, 10:54:22 AMWell with this type of setup, the templates are just an extension as well, to be manipulated.
Quote from: texasman1979 on April 29, 2011, 10:54:22 AMMy practical expertise limits my ability to explain my thought as good as id like to, but all of you main developers if either smf or its future forks, coders of mods both novice and pro, really look at what im saying. Your seeing the forest, not the road that actually there, you just need to move the trees.